Anecdotal records from boat skippers indicate that over 70 seals were recorded as hauling out on the river banks near Pegwell Bay in 2011; while records held by Sandwich Bay Bird Observatory show over 110 common seals as having been recorded hauled out on at least one occasion in that year. Pegwell Bay, Kent – a Recollection of October 5th 1858 is an oil-on-canvas painting by British artist William Dyce, depicting the landscape at Pegwell Bay, on the east coast of Kent.Considered a Pre-Raphaelite work, Dyce employs a mode of heightened realism and intricate detail to create a powerful landscape. Pegwell Bay is famous for the excellent preservation in very soft chalks of fossil echinoderms and (towards the higher part of the succession) for the relative abundance of giant ammonites. Pegwell Bay is a shallow inlet in the English Channel coast astride the estuary of the River Stour north of Sandwich Bay, between Ramsgate and Sandwich in Kent.Part of the bay is a nature reserve, with seashore habitats including mudflats and salt marsh with migrating waders and wildfowl.The public can access the nature reserve via Pegwell Bay … Picture Story British Isles Seals Great Britain The Locals Beautiful Places Weird Wildlife Creatures.
